Critics Ratings
Lafon Les Héritiers du Comte Lafon Mâcon-Milly-Lamartine 2015'
The 2015 Macon Milly Lamartine has a lovely apple blossom and limestone-scented bouquet that unfurls wonderfully in the glass but retains its elegance. The palate is well balanced with crisp acidity, saline in the mouth with a precise and detailed finish. This is an excellent, quite nuanced wine that might be holding something up its sleeve for later.' - Neal Martin, Wine Advocate (Aug 2017)
‘A whiff of reduction doesn't mask the cooler underlying aromas of pear, apple, quinine and citrus zest. The round, delicious and slightly more vibrant flavors deliver excellent length if perhaps not quite the same depth on the zippier and slightly drier finish. This too is really very good for what it is.’ - Allen Meadows, Burghound.com (Oct 2017)
‘This is a cooler terroir than Mâcon-Prissé, and it has produced a beautifully floral wine in 2015, bursting with citrus zest and white flowers. There is nice focus, cut and grip on the finish.' - William Kelley, Decanter
‘(bottled in July; a blend of two big east-facing vineyards located far from the river at an altitude of 400 meters, picked at the end in 2015, on September 9; done in foudres and demi-muids ): Subtle aromas of lemon and white flowers. Rich but tight, showing a youthful sweet/sour quality owing to its very sound acidity for the year (4.5 grams per liter, according to Gon, who noted that she did no acidification in 2015). Saline more than fruity today and in need of time in bottle to harmonize.’ - Stephen Tanzver, Vinous (Sep 2016)
Lafon Les Héritiers du Comte Lafon Mâcon-Uchizy Les Maranche 2015
‘The 2015 Macon Uchizy les Maranches has a clean and precise bouquet, quite chalky and well defined, a more neutral take on Mâcon that expresses more of the terroir rather than fruit. The palate is fresh on the entry with crisp acidity, not quite as detailed as I was expecting after the aromatics but with satisfying weight on the spicy, quite sappy finish.' - Neal Martin, Wine Advocate (Aug 2017)
‘Here the reduction is a bit more prominent though not so much as to completely mask the underlying aromas of citrus and pear. Otherwise there is good mid-palate volume to the round, fleshy and citrus-inflected flavors that possess better length than depth though this is also really quite good.’ - Allen Meadows, Burghound.com, (Oct 2017)
‘(from a blend of old and young vines in a very warm spot--always with the lowest acidity in the cellar, according to Gon, who noted that the young vines bring needed freshness): Pure Chardonnay stone fruit aromas show an exotic, candied aspect. Then surprisingly juicy and energetic, even youthfully bound-up, with a fresh apricot flavor dominating in the early going. A bit simple today, and slightly phenolic on the back end. The nose is very ripe but the palate suggests early picking.’ - Stephen Tanzer, Vinous (Sep 2016)
